When eggshells go down the drain, even small bits can stick together with moisture and other debris in the pipes. Over time, these fragments can gather and form a larger blockage. Eggshells can also mix with grease and food, making tough clogs that are hard to clear.
The rough surface of eggshells can wear down pipes, especially in older plumbing, leading to leaks and more problems. It is important to be careful with eggshell disposal to keep your plumbing in good shape.
